How to prepare for a job interview at HUWS GRAY LIMITED
✨Know Your Inventory Basics
Before the interview, brush up on your inventory management principles. Understand key concepts like stock turnover, demand forecasting, and inventory optimisation. This will show that you’re not just familiar with the role but also passionate about improving stock efficiency.
✨Research Huws Gray Group
Take some time to learn about Huws Gray Group’s operations, values, and recent developments. Knowing their business model and how they manage their inventory can help you tailor your answers and demonstrate your genuine interest in the company.
✨Prepare for Scenario Questions
Expect questions that ask you to solve hypothetical inventory challenges. Think of examples from your past experience where you improved stock efficiency or dealt with supply chain issues.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ses clearly.
✨Show Your Analytical Skills
As an Inventory Planner, analytical skills are crucial. Be ready to discuss any tools or software you’ve used for inventory analysis. If you have experience with data analysis or reporting, highlight it during the interview to showcase your ability to make data-driven decisions.
